  • Abstract
    Perhaps, this paper reports the ®rst successful applications of the topology optimization in the design of (thin- walled) beam sections. In particular, topologically di€erent thin-walled beam cross sections can be obtained by the present approach, which is very useful in identifying the direction and location of sti€eners. In formulating the topology optimization problems, a simple power law is used for the relation between the density of an element with a hole and the mechanical properties of the element.
